When was Western Sydney University Established?

Western Sydney University Australia was established in the year 1989 by the Western Sydney Act, 1988. It is formerly known as the University of Western Sydney that was later restructured by merging of two federated institutions.

Where is Western Sydney University?

Western Sydney University is located in Penrith which is in the Greater Western Region of Sydney, Australia.

Student Population at Technical University Dortmund

TU Dortmund has a large uniRank enrollment and so has a large student population. The university attracts students because of its courses and support services. TUDO enrolls a total number of 34,300 students out of which 11% are international students from around 113 countries. The university intakes a total number of 4,000 international students. These students are distributed in many courses.

Admission Details

How can I get into the Technical University Dortmund?

TU Dortmund accepts online admissions during the summer and winter semesters. German and English proficiency is required to seek admission as most of the UG and PG courses are taught in these two languages. The admissions take place through an online portal and have certain requirements that are mentioned below:

  • The students should pass German language tests like DSH and TEstDAF to a minimum of level 2 or level 3.
  • Goethe Certificate of C2 level is required.
  • English proficiency is tested by IELTS and TOEFL scores.
  • A minimum IELTS requirement is 6 points and a minimum TOEFL requirement is 95 points.
  • Students opting for graduate admissions should have work experience
  • The graduate and undergraduate admissions are not charged any application fee.

Following documents are required during the admissions at Technical University Dortmund:

  1. Letter of conformed admission from TU Dortmund
  2. School Certificate and Academic Records
  3. Proof pf finance and funding
  4. Proof of health 
  5. Valid Passport and Visa 
  6. Translation Documents and language proficiency proof. 
  7. Resume

Average Tuition Fees

TU Dortmund does not charge any tuition fee from its students. Non-EU students also do not have to pay any tuition fee. But the students have to pay a course fee depending on the degree courses. The students only have to pay a semester fee of €300 that even covers the transportation costs.

Other Fees

What is the Average Annual Cost to attend the Technical University of Dortmund?

The students at TU Dortmund are not charged any tuition fee but they have to pay some other expenses that include housing costs, food, health, and other personal expenses. The transportation cost is covered by the semester ticket worth €300. The other expenses at TU Dortmund are as below:

Types of Expenses Monthly Costs
Rent with all the services €323
Food and Cafe €168
Books and learning materials €20
Health Insurance €80
Public Transport €94
Phone and Internet €41
Leisure and Personal Expenses €61
